The code of principles of the International Fact-Checking Network IFCN at Poynter is a series of commitments organizations abide by to promote excellence in fact-checking. The following fact checks come from IFCN fact checkers. (D. Van Zandt)

Claim by Joe Biden: The Trump administration made no effort to get U.S. medical experts into China as the novel coronavirus epidemic spread there early this year. Factcheck.org rating: False |

Claim via Social Media: An image shared on Facebook claims Amazon is suspending all deliveries except for medical supplies during the ongoing coronavirus pandemic.
Check Your Fact rating: False FACT CHECK: IS AMAZON SUSPENDING ALL DELIVERIES EXCEPT FOR MEDICAL SUPPLIES DUE TO CORONAVIRUS? |

Claim by Bloggers: Says President Donald Trump will announce that a scientist “finally found vaccine to cure corona virus.” Politifact rating: Pants on Fire Spam news websites spread false claim about coronavirus vaccine |

Claim by the Buffalo Chronicle: Is New York State about to ban cigarette sales to combat the novel coronavirus?
Lead Stories rating: False Fact Check: New York Is NOT Banning Cigarette Sales To Combat COVID-19 |

Claim by U.S. Surgeon General Jerome Adams: “They’re furloughing nurses in hospitals in western New York state.” Politifact rating: False Hospitals refute surgeon general’s claim about nursing furloughs |

(International) Claim: 500 body bags were delivered to an ice skating rink outside the Australian city of Adelaide.
AFP Fact Check (France) rating: False |
